TROUBLESHOOTING
If your air conditioner does not work properly, fi rst check the following points before requesting service. If it still does not work
properly, contact your dealer or a service center.
INDOOR UNIT
Symptom Cause
Noise Sound like streaming water during
operation or after operation
Sound of refrigerant liquid fl owing inside unit
Sound of drainage water through drain pipe
Cracking noise during operation or
when operation stops.
Cracking sound due to temperature changes of parts
Odor Discharged air is smelled during
operation.
Indoor odor components, cigarette odor and cosmetic odor accumurated
in the air conditioner and its air is discharged.
Unit inside is dusty. Consult your dealer.
Dewdrop Dewdrop gets accumurated near air
discharge during operation
Indoor moisture is cooled by cool wind and accumulated by dewdrop.
Fog Fog occurs during operation in
cooling mode.
(Places where large amounts of oil
mist exist at restaurants.)
Cleaning is necessary because unit inside (heat exchanger) is dirty.
Consult your dealer as technical engineering is required.
During defrost operation
Fan is rotating for a while even though operation
stops.
Fan rotating makes operation smoothly.
Fan may sometimes rotates because of drying heat exchanger due to
settings.
Wind-direction changes while operating.
Wind-direction setting cannot be made.
Wind-direction cannot be changed.
When air discharge temperature is low or during defrost operation,
horizontal wind fl ow is made automatically.
Flap position is occasionally set up individually.
When wind-direction is changed, fl ap operates
several times and stops at designated position.
When wind-direction is changed, fl ap operates after searching for
standard position.
Dust Dust accumulation inside indoor unit is discharged.
OUTDOOR UNIT
Symptom Cause
No
operation
When power is turned ON instantly. Operation is not acticated for the fi rst approx. 3 minutes because
compressor protection circuit is activated.
When operation is stopped and
resumed immediately.
Noise Noise often occurs in heating mode. During defrost operation
Steam Steam often occurs in heating mode.
When stopped by remote controller, outdoor unit
fan is sometimes operating for a while even though
outdoor compressor is stopped.
Fan rotating makes operation smoothly.
